Albania is a small country located in Southeast Europe on the Balkan Peninsula. It has a population of around 2.8 million people. Albania is known for its rich history, which includes influences from the Greeks, Romans, and Ottomans. The country has a diverse culture with unique traditions, music, and dance. Albania's economy is growing, with agriculture, energy, and tourism playing significant roles.

Albania is famous for its beautiful landscapes, which include mountains, beaches, and lakes. The Albanian Riviera is a popular destination, known for its stunning coastline along the Adriatic and Ionian Seas. Another highlight is Lake Ohrid, one of Europe's oldest and deepest lakes, offering picturesque views and a peaceful atmosphere. The capital city, Tirana, is a vibrant place with colorful buildings, lively cafes, and historical sites.

Visitors to Albania can explore the ancient city of Butrint, a UNESCO World Heritage Site with impressive archaeological ruins. The town of Gjirokastër, known for its well-preserved Ottoman architecture, is another must-see. The Albanian Alps provide opportunities for hiking and enjoying nature. With its mix of history, culture, and natural beauty, Albania offers a unique travel experience.

The top cities in Albania by population include Tirana, which is the capital and largest city, followed by Durrës, Vlorë, and Shkodër. Tirana serves as the political, economic, and cultural center of the country.
